ResearchGate: Collaborative Documentation Practices in Behavioral Healthcare


ResearchGate significantly enhances communication among behavioral healthcare providers by promoting collaboration. This platform not only improves the thoroughness and precision of documentation but also actively involves individuals in their treatment process. By encouraging the participation of patients, it fosters a sense of ownership and engagement, which is crucial for improved health outcomes.

Providers have noted that incorporating patient feedback enhances clarity and builds trust, ultimately reinforcing the therapeutic alliance. As Scott Lloyd aptly puts it, "If we’re not incorporating them in records, are we truly valuing their opinion?" This highlights the critical role of patient involvement in care, which is essential for effective treatment and adherence to therapeutic plans.

The impact of this approach is evident: after transitioning to collaborative record-keeping, an impressive 94% of notes were completed on the same day as the client session. This statistic not only showcases the effectiveness of this method but also underscores the importance of timely documentation in fostering better healthcare outcomes.

Kareo: Cloud-Based Documentation and Billing Solutions


Kareo stands out as a solution tailored specifically for behavioral care providers, offering robust record-keeping and billing solutions. With its comprehensive suite of features including electronic medical records, billing management, and client engagement tools, Kareo is designed to improve documentation efficiency.

Consider this: administrative tasks can consume up to 35% of clinicians' time. By leveraging Kareo, mental health practices can streamline operations, alleviating these burdens. This efficiency not only reduces administrative workload but also fosters better patient care and satisfaction.

Kareo sets a high standard with a clean claims rate target of 90% or higher, effectively minimizing claim denials. Common reasons for these denials include:

  • Missing information (45%)
  • Eligibility issues (24%)

Consequently, organizations utilizing Kareo can anticipate increased revenue, as effective billing management directly correlates with enhanced revenue performance.

In summary, Kareo empowers behavioral health practices with a comprehensive solution, enabling them to focus on what truly matters - providing exceptional patient care - while ensuring their administrative processes are efficient and compliant.
